Shadow play or shadow puppetry is a traditional form of storytelling and has a long history in Southeast Asia namely, Malaysia, Indonesia, Thailand and Cambodia. Shadow play uses flat, cut-out figures shadow puppets which are held between an oil lamp or halogen lamp and a white muslin cloth.
